Ransomware is exploiting factory VPNs: Manufacturers should rethink OT remote access governance, says Secomea

Published

on

Just-in-time vendor access, auditability, and containment are key controls for reducing ransomware risk in manufacturing, according to Secomea

COPENHAGEN, Denmark, June 30, 2026 /PRNewswire/ — Following a recent increase in publicly reported ransomware and extortion incidents affecting manufacturers and industrial suppliers, Secomea is urging organizations to reassess how third-party remote access is managed across production environments.

In operational technology (OT) environments, third-party remote access is essential for maintenance, troubleshooting, and equipment support. However, as ransomware groups increasingly target manufacturing organizations, security teams are facing growing pressure to balance operational continuity with cybersecurity, compliance, and vendor access control.

“Many organizations focus on keeping attackers out, but far fewer examine how much access is available once someone gets in,” said Knud Kegel, CTPO at Secomea. “In manufacturing environments, remote access is essential for keeping operations running. The challenge is making sure that access is controlled, temporary, and visible.”

Manufacturers rely on machine builders, system integrators, and service providers to support critical equipment remotely. However, always-on access, shared credentials, and limited oversight can create opportunities for attackers to move through environments once an initial compromise occurs.

While the specific circumstances vary from incident to incident, recent attacks highlight a common challenge: balancing operational access with security and oversight.

According to Secomea, organizations should focus on three areas:

Reduce standing access
Vendor access should be granted only when needed and removed when the task is complete. Limiting access windows reduces the opportunity for misuse, credential abuse, and unauthorized activity.

Improve visibility and accountability
Organizations should be able to see who accessed systems, when they connected, and what actions were performed. Detailed audit trails support investigations, compliance requirements, cyber insurance reporting, and incident response.

Prepare for containment
When suspicious activity is detected, security and operations teams need practical ways to isolate affected assets and prevent disruptions from spreading across production environments.

Effective OT access governance combines least-privilege access, just-in-time vendor access, auditability, and rapid containment to reduce cyber risk while maintaining operational continuity.

These measures have become increasingly important as manufacturers face growing regulatory scrutiny, rising cyber insurance requirements, and continued pressure to maintain operational uptime.

Practical steps for ransomware-ready OT remote access

As manufacturers review their cyber resilience strategies, Secomea recommends assessing whether the following controls and processes are in place:

Just-in-time vendor access instead of persistent remote connectionsApproval-based workflows for access to critical systemsLeast-privilege permissions for users and vendorsAudit trails that support investigations, compliance, and forensic analysisThe ability to quickly isolate affected assets during an incident

“The conversation is shifting from simply enabling remote access to governing it,” said Knud Kegel. “Manufacturers do not need less connectivity. They need better governance of that connectivity. Organizations that can limit, monitor, and contain access are often better positioned to reduce operational impact when incidents occur.”

“Ransomware resilience in manufacturing increasingly depends on how organizations govern remote access to OT systems,” added Knud. “Just-in-time vendor access, visibility into remote sessions, and the ability to contain affected assets are becoming foundational cybersecurity controls.”

BERLIN, Sept. 6, 2026 /PRNewswire/ — Tuya Smart (NYSE: TUYA; HKEX: 2391), a global AI cloud platform service provider, is showcasing its latest advances in physical AI at IFA 2026 under the theme “Hey Tuya.”

Headlining the exhibit is the global debut of the new AI companion robot Doova, alongside the European debut of Tuya’s AI Home, AI Energy, and AI Robot ecosystems, the Hey Tuya whole-space intelligent interaction experience, a full-stack Matter portfolio, and development tools designed to help turn AI hardware concepts into working products.

The showcase illustrates how Tuya is connecting cloud intelligence, devices, and developer tools to move AI beyond screens and into practical use across homes, energy systems, robotics, pet care, and personal assistance.

Doova Extends Physical AI to Home Companionship and Assistance

Following the debut of Aura, Tuya’s AI companion robot for pets, Tuya is expanding its robotics portfolio with Doova, a home companion robot designed for independently living seniors to combine emotional companionship, everyday assistance, health-related reminders, and home monitoring. Doova is equipped with LDS LiDAR, sound source localization, and AI vision-based posture recognition algorithms.

Doova can respond to a simple voice request for help and navigate to the user’s location, assess their posture, and, if necessary, place a video call to family members. Day to day, it can hold conversations, play audio and video, help users understand complex bills and letters, flag potential fraud risks, and guide them through the operation of smart appliances. It can also provide medication, weather, and schedule reminders, along with practical suggestions related to meals, gardening, and clothing. When users are away, Doova can patrol the home and generate a security report.

Together, these capabilities demonstrate how physical AI can combine contextual awareness with connected-device control to support more responsive and accessible living experiences.

AI Home, AI Robot, and AI Energy Make Their European Debut

At IFA 2026, Tuya is presenting its AI Home, AI Robot, and AI Energy application ecosystems together in Europe for the first time, combined with the Company’s full-stack Matter solutions.

AI Home brings together a range of AI-powered devices, including an AI radar sleep speaker, AI printer, baby monitor, AI flower pot, and AI learning companion, extending AI capabilities into everyday scenarios such as home care, pet care, and plant care.

For example, the AI radar sleep speaker integrates millimeter-wave radar technology to accurately detect user activity and trigger adaptive smart home functions—such as automatically turning off the lights once the user falls asleep. It can also monitor heart rate, breathing, and snoring in real time to generate daily sleep analysis reports. In addition, built-in white noise, natural soundscapes, and meditation music help users relax and drift into sleep more easily.

The smart pet collar uses sensitive audio capture and AI-based emotion analysis to interpret changes in a pet’s vocalizations and breathing. The AI radar speaker combines natural-language control of connected devices with contactless radar sensing for heart rate, breathing, snoring, and sleep quality, alongside functions such as alarms, focus timers, and white noise.

AI Robot products span pet care, interactive collectibles, and desktop tools, including Aura, Fuzozo, Walulu, an AI owl, and an AI robot dog. Aura combines behavioral analysis and sound recognition to interpret a pet’s emotional state, while features such as laser play, treat dispensing, and simulated pet sounds support interactive companionship.

Tuya AI Energy connects balcony solar and storage, smart metering and distribution, and EV charging into a household energy network spanning generation, storage, measurement, management, and consumption. By integrating real-time and dynamic tariff data from more than 800 electricity providers and more than 1,000 dynamic tariff service providers across Europe, the system intelligently shifts household loads to help reduce overall energy costs, improving energy efficiency and reshaping the value proposition of home energy storage. The exhibit demonstrates how Tuya’s energy management capabilities coordinate infrastructure and connected devices across the home.

A Full-Stack Matter Portfolio for Interoperable Products

Tuya is also showcasing an end-to-end Matter portfolio spanning chip modules and cloud services. The offering supports Matter over Wi-Fi, Matter over Thread, and Ethernet, as well as bridges from Zigbee, Bluetooth, and Wi-Fi to Matter. It covers product categories including gateways, central control panels, lighting, plugs, sensors, curtain motors, thermostatic radiator valves, locks, and cameras.

Beyond standard Matter capabilities, Tuya layers on distinctive features — remote management, energy tracking, music-synced lighting — and integrates ecosystem tools like Amazon Frustration-Free Setup and the Google Matter API — allowing products to achieve cross-platform interoperability while preserving a differentiated user experience.

Hey Tuya Coordinates the Connected Home through Natural Language

Built on a multi-agent collaborative architecture, Hey Tuya is designed to coordinate services and devices across everyday scenarios rather than operate as a single-device assistant. Users can issue natural-language commands such as “Turn on the dining room lights” or “I’m leaving — activate monitoring,” allowing multiple devices and scenes to respond together.

The experience centers on four capabilities: round-the-clock home security monitoring; energy analysis and personalized efficiency recommendations; natural-language control and automation across multiple devices; and personalized services that adapt to household routines and preferences.

Tuya plans to continue improving the reliability, response speed, and task execution of Hey Tuya, while exploring subscription and value-added services in areas such as energy optimization, pet care, and video understanding.

Developer Tools Shorten the Path from Concept to Working Hardware

Tuya’s developer showcase presents a full technology stack for AI hardware development, where visitors can experience firsthand how ideas can be rapidly turned into functional AI applications that interact with and enhance daily life through the TuyaOpen open-source framework, Tuya Cobuilder, and Tuya AI Coding.

Tuya Cobuilder is an end-to-end Physical AI Builder designed for AI hardware developers. By simply describing an AI hardware concept in natural language, users can complete the entire development workflow in one place, ultimately enabling the application to run directly on real hardware. Tuya AI Coding, the Company’s AI-native no-code application development platform, lets users turn ideas into AI-powered applications with a single prompt—enabling non-technical creators to become builders of AI-powered experiences.

By bringing AI applications, interoperable device infrastructure, and development tools into one ecosystem, Tuya aims to help its global AIoT developer ecosystem create practical AI products more efficiently. The Company will continue advancing AI Home, AI Energy, and AI Robot applications and collaborating with developers and partners to make intelligent living safer, more convenient, and more responsive to individual needs.

BERLIN, Sept. 6, 2026 /PRNewswire/ — At IFA 2026, Changhong unveiled a new lineup of AI-powered home appliances spanning TVs, refrigerators, air conditioners and laundry appliances. Centered on real-life scenarios, the company is bringing AI technologies designed to better understand everyday needs into the product experience, highlighting its transition from technological innovation toward more intuitive living experiences. The showcase also signals Changhong’s continued localization efforts.

The concept comes to life across Changhong’s latest AI products. The Q60S Pro TV features the Changhong LeDong AI sports platform, extending the TV beyond a traditional content screen into a space for family fitness and interaction. An AI human-sensing air conditioner can recognize users’ locations and habits and adjust airflow accordingly, while an AI refrigerator uses intelligent sensing to help users take a more proactive approach to food freshness. Rather than adding complexity, Changhong is making everyday life simpler.

This is at the heart of Changhong’s exploration of “seamless technology”—technology that works quietly in the background. The best technology does not always need to be seen; it simply helps people worry less.

A distinctive cultural element is also finding its way into Changhong’s smart product experience. The brand has incorporated the giant panda into AI assistant interactions, bringing greater warmth and approachability to AI-powered TVs and other home appliances. Closely associated with Changhong’s Sichuan heritage, the panda also provides a natural way to bring a recognizable element of Chinese culture into the technology experience.

Skiing offers another bridge to European lifestyles. In recent years, Changhong has continued to strengthen its presence in Europe with CHiQ as an important brand vehicle, building closer connections with local consumers through sports partnerships, including sponsorship of FIS Ski World Cup events in Germany, collaboration with the German Ski Association and its role as an official partner of the FIS Ski Jumping World Cup. More than a sporting platform, skiing allows CHiQ to connect the speed, passion and outdoor spirit of the sport with its product experience, bringing technology closer to the way European consumers live.

Behind these initiatives is a deeper commitment to localization. From product experience and brand expression to sports, culture and local lifestyles, Changhong is creating more diverse touchpoints with the European market. From “going global” to “going local,” the company is moving beyond products and channels toward a deeper integration of its brands, technology and the markets it serves.

CoolFly to Showcase Personal Flight Portfolio and NA80 Flight-Control Technology at IFA Berlin 2026

Published

on

By

Dream ST will be on display as CoolFly highlights flagship Urban, high-performance Dream Pro and its expanding global dealer network

BERLIN, Sept. 6, 2026 /PRNewswire/ — CoolFly, a developer of personal electric aircraft and eVTOL technologies, is showcasing its Dream ST personal aircraft at IFA Berlin 2026, taking place September 4–8 at Messe Berlin.

Dream ST is on display at CityCube Hall B, Booth CCBB-143, in IFA’s Mobility area. While Dream ST is the aircraft physically presented at the show, CoolFly is also introducing its broader product portfolio, including high-performance Dream Pro and flagship Urban.

Dream ST is a lightweight, single-seat electric aircraft designed for personal and recreational flight, featuring a seated configuration and quick-fold design for easier transportation and storage.

Dream Pro extends the platform with greater payload, endurance and performance. It supports a maximum payload of 120 kg, reaches a maximum speed of 100 km/h, and can achieve up to 40 minutes of flight time with a 70 kg pilot onboard, depending on operating and environmental conditions.

Urban, CoolFly’s flagship personal aircraft, features a standing-position configuration and enclosed-propeller architecture, reflecting the company’s effort to create a more intuitive and distinctive personal flight experience.

All three aircraft share CoolFly’s self-developed NA80 flight control system. NA80 uses a dual-redundant architecture with two independent flight-control units, each integrating three aviation-grade inertial measurement units (IMUs). The system continuously monitors aircraft attitude and motion, supports millisecond-level fault detection and failover, and serves as a common technology foundation across CoolFly’s product portfolio.

Dream ST, Dream Pro and Urban have all obtained CE and FCC certifications for applicable product compliance requirements, supporting CoolFly’s continued international expansion.
